Structural Characteristics and Mixing Principle
The internal structure of JHF series enhanced heat transfer reactor is similar to that of static mixer, which can make different liquids entering the enhanced heat transfer mixer mix well with each other. However, unlike conventional static mixer internal units, the internal components of JHF series enhanced heat transfer reactor are not made of plates, but of finer tubes, which can pass through heating medium or cooling medium, so the internal units can not only pass through heating medium, but also through cooling medium. Full mixing is achieved and a large heat transfer specific surface area is provided.
1. Product Characteristics
JHF-IV type enhanced heat transfer mixing reactor can make different fluids into it mix well with each other, and can also enhance the heat transfer process of high viscosity medium, so it is particularly suitable for use as a polymerization reactor. The uniform temperature distribution at the same cross section in JHF-IV is beneficial not only to improve the quality of polymer products, but also to improve the conversion of polymerization. From monomer to complete polymerization, the viscosity of the reaction material changes from small to large, and the higher the degree of polymerization, the higher the viscosity.
